2016 - 2025

感恩一路有你

Excel计算一个月多少天

浏览量:3205 时间:2024-06-27 12:23:41 作者:采采

Excel是一款功能强大的电子表格软件,它可以进行各种复杂的数据处理和计算。在日常工作中,我们经常需要计算一个月究竟有多少天。本文将介绍使用VBA编程来实现这一功能。

步骤一:打开Excel,进入VBE编程环境

首先,打开Excel并创建一个新的工作簿。然后,按下“Alt F11”键,进入Visual Basic Editor(VBE)编程环境。

步骤二:插入模块

在VBE编程环境中,选择“插入”菜单,然后选择“模块”。这将在项目浏览器中创建一个新的模块。

步骤三:输入月份

在新创建的模块中,我们可以开始编写VBA代码。首先,我们需要输入要计算的月份。可以使用一个变量来接收用户输入的月份值。

步骤四:大月都是31天

对于大月,即1、3、5、7、8、10和12月,它们都是31天。我们可以使用多分支选择语句()来判断输入的月份是否为大月。

步骤五:小月都是30天

对于小月,即4、6、9和11月,它们都是30天。我们可以在之前的多分支选择语句中添加条件来判断输入的月份是否为小月。

步骤六:二月最特殊,需要输入年份再计算

对于二月,它是最特殊的月份。它的天数根据年份而定。平年二月有28天,而闰年二月有29天。因此,我们需要先输入年份,然后再根据年份判断二月的天数。

步骤七:关闭VBE,在表格界面启动宏

完成VBA代码的编写后,保存并关闭VBE编程环境。返回到Excel的表格界面。

步骤八:执行宏

在Excel的表格界面上,按下“Alt F8”键,打开宏对话框。选择我们之前编写的宏,并点击“运行”按钮。这将执行我们的VBA代码,并计算出输入月份的天数。

步骤九:输入月份,例如11.10,计算结果

在宏的运行过程中,会出现一个输入框,要求输入月份。我们可以输入11.10作为示例。根据我们之前编写的VBA代码,程序将计算出11月有30天,并将结果显示在一个消息框中。

通过以上步骤,我们可以实现在Excel中计算一个月有多少天的功能。利用VBA编程,我们可以根据不同的输入情况进行多分支选择,灵活地处理各种日期计算问题。这对于需要频繁进行日期计算的用户来说,将大大提高工作效率。

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。